To create these delicious crispy garlic chicken drumsticks, you’ll need a simple yet flavorful list of ingredients that you might already have in your pantry. Here’s what you’ll need:
– 10 chicken drumsticks: The star of the show, these tender morsels of meat are perfect for frying. Choose fresh or thawed drumsticks for the best results.
– 4 cloves garlic, minced: Garlic adds that irresistible, aromatic flavor that elevates the dish.
– 1 cup buttermilk: This ingredient not only tenderizes the chicken but also infuses it with a rich flavor, ensuring juicy results.
– 1 cup all-purpose flour: Essential for creating that crunchy, golden coating that everyone loves.
– 1 teaspoon paprika: This spice adds a subtle smokiness and beautiful color to the crust.
– 1 teaspoon onion powder: Enhances the overall savory flavor of the chicken.
– 1 teaspoon garlic powder: For that extra garlicky goodness that complements the fresh garlic.
– 1 teaspoon salt: Essential for seasoning, bringing out the natural flavors of the chicken.
– ½ teaspoon black pepper: Adds a nice kick and depth to the flavor profile.
– ½ te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ional for heat): A touch of heat for those who enjoy a bit of spice in their meals.
– ½ teaspoon dried thyme: Provides an earthy depth that rounds out the flavors beautifully.
Now that we have gathered all the ingredients, it’s time to get started on preparing our crispy garlic chicken drumsticks. The first step in this process is to marinate the chicken, which is crucial for achieving maximum flavor and juiciness.
1. Marinate the Drumsticks:
– In a large mixing bowl, combine the buttermilk, minced garlic, and a pinch of salt. This mixture will serve as both a marinade and a tenderizer for the chicken.
– Add the chicken drumsticks to the bowl, ensuring that they are fully submerged in the buttermilk mixture. If you like, you can use a resealable plastic bag for easier handling and marinating.
– Cover the bowl or seal the bag and refrigerate for at least 1 hour, or ideally overnight. The longer the chicken marinates, the more flavorful it will become.
2. Prepare the Coating:
– While the chicken is marinating, it’s time to prepare the flour coating. In a separate bowl, combine the all-purpose flour, paprika, onion powder, garlic powder, salt, black pepper, cayenne pepper (if using), and dried thyme.
– Whisk the dry ingredients together until they are evenly mixed. This will ensure that every bite of chicken is perfectly seasoned and crispy.
3. Coat the Drumsticks:
– After the marinating time has elapsed, remove the chicken drumsticks from the refrigerator. Allow any excess buttermilk to drip off before coating them in the flour mixture.
– Dredge each drumstick in the seasoned flour, pressing gently to ensure the coating adheres well to the chicken. Shake off any excess flour and set the coated drumsticks aside on a plate or wire rack while you prepare the frying oil.
Once the drumsticks are coated and ready, it’s time to fry them to crispy perfection. The frying process is where the magic truly happens, giving the drumsticks their signature crunch and golden-brown color.
1. Heat the Oil:
– In a large, deep skillet or frying pan, pour enough oil to submerge the drumsticks halfway. Use an oil with a high smoke point, such as vegetable oil, canola oil, or peanut oil.
– Heat the oil over medium-high heat until it reaches about 350°F (175°C). You can check the temperature using a kitchen thermometer or by dropping a small amount of flour into the oil; if it sizzles and bubbles, it’s ready.
2. Fry the Drumsticks:
– Carefully place the coated drumsticks in the hot oil, ensuring not to overcrowd the pan. Fry in batches if necessary to maintain the oil temperature.
– Cook the drumsticks for about 12-15 minutes, turning them occasionally to ensure even cooking. The chicken is done when it re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C) and the coating is golden brown and crispy.
3. Drain and Serve:
– Once cooked, remove the drumsticks from the oil and place them on a paper towel-lined plate to drain any excess oil. This will help to keep them crispy.

To ensure your crispy garlic chicken drumsticks turn out perfectly every time, here are a few handy tips:
– Marination Time: Don’t rush the marination process. For the best flavor and tenderness, aim for an overnight soak in the buttermilk and garlic. This allows the chicken to absorb all the flavors fully.
– Adjust Spice Levels: If you’re cooking for a crowd, consider leaving out the cayenne pepper for those who prefer milder flavors. You can always serve it on the side as a spicy dipping sauce for your adventurous guests.
– Double Dredging: For an extra crunchy texture, consider double dredging the drumsticks. After the first coating, dip them back into the buttermilk and then into the flour mixture again before frying.
– Use a Thermometer: A meat thermometer is a great tool to ensure your chicken is cooked perfectly. Remember that the internal temperature of the chicken should reach 165°F (75°C) for safe consumption.
– Resting Period: Allowing the fried drumsticks to rest on paper towels not only helps remove excess oil but also allows the juices to redistribute, making the meat even more tender.
These crispy garlic chicken drumsticks are incredibly versatile and can be served in various ways to suit your meal preferences. Here are some delicious serving suggestions:
– With Dipping Sauces: Serve your drumsticks with a variety of dipping sauces such as ranch dressing, honey mustard, or a spicy sriracha mayo. A tangy buffalo sauce also pairs beautifully with the garlic flavors.
– Side Dishes: Complement the drumsticks with classic sides like coleslaw, potato salad, or corn on the cob. A fresh garden salad with a vinaigrette dressing can also balance the richness of the fried chicken.
– As Part of a Platter: Arrange the drumsticks on a large platter with fresh vegetables, pickles, and assorted cheeses for a fun and casual gathering. This makes for a great party dish where guests can help themselves.
– In a Wrap or Sandwich: Shred any leftover chicken and use it in wraps or sandwiches. Adding lettuce, tomatoes, and a spicy sauce can create a delicious meal for lunch or dinner.
– Garnish with Fresh Herbs: Just before serving, sprinkle freshly chopped parsley over the drumsticks for a pop of color and a burst of fresh flavor.
